Chief Legal Officer and Corporate Secretary

The Role:


The Chief Legal Officer and Corporate Secretary leads the legal services portfolio and provides support to the Board of Directors.

The position works closely with the CEO and Board Chair.


Key Responsibilities

  • Provides practical, solutionoriented, riskbased legal advice on a broad spectrum of the agency's operational and strategic work.
  • Engages and manages external legal counsel, as necessary.
  • Advises the Board on corporate governance matters, maintains corporate minute book, drafts resolutions, and attends all Board and Board Committee meetings. Leads meeting scheduling, agenda preparation, creation and review of meeting materials, for Board of Directors meetings and the Board's Governance and Human Resources Committee meetings.
  • Acts as a strategic partner with the President and Chief Executive Officer and other PHO executive team members, to define, action and model the agency's vision, mission and values and actively contribute to developing and articulating a vision for PHO's role in the public health sector. Champions the organization's values and ethical standards in all agency business.
  • Develops and maintains various corporate and Board policies, processes and practices to enable the organization to meet its obligations and accountabilities as a Crown agency, and follow best practices in board governance.

Knowledge and Skills

  • Demonstrated knowledge of relevant legal practice areas, including Crown agency governance (relevant legislation, regulations, and government directives), procurement, conflict of interest, freedom of information and privacy law in the health sector, information technology, and contract law.
  • Ability to communicate complex legal concepts to a variety of audiences

Education and Experience

  • Membership in good standing as a lawyer with the Law Society of Ontario.
  • Minimum 5 years corporate commercial legal experience, preferably in the public and/or healthcare sector.
  • Previous experience as a corporate secretary, preferably in the public and/or healthcare sector.
  • Proven ability to produce highquality work under tight deadlines with changing and competing demands
  • Experience with government decisionmaking processes and procedures is preferred.
  • Proven expertise in developing and maintaining executive level relationships with senior government officials, members of Boards of Directors and health system leaders.

Attributes and Competencies

  • Acts as a strategic partner with the President and CEO and Executive counterparts to ensure that the leadership team of the organization receives the necessary strategic legal advice.
  • Demonstrated commitment to and experience in leading by example, exercising sound judgment in interpersonal engagements, displaying integrity and emotional intelligence in decisionmaking and prioritizing respect and authenticity in relationships.
  • Skilled in building, supporting and inspiring multidisciplinary team members with varied expertise and experience.
